Learning Obstacle in Understanding Basic Trigonometric Equations

Abstract

The purpose of this study is to analyze the learning obstacle that student commit in basic trigonometric equations. This study used descriptive qualitative method, employing phenomenological research design. The focus of the phenomenon in this study is the obstacles that student commit in basic trigonometric equations. Data was collected through a test that was tested to 11th grade students who had learned basic trigonometric equations. The result showed that the learning obstacle that student commit in basic trigonometric equations have been categorized into 3 (three) types, that is learning obstacle of concept image, learning obstacle that related to various information and learning obstacle in mathematical representation.
